Beach Volleyball Nationals head to Spanish Banks this weekend!

The Beach Volleyball National Championships are back at Spanish Banks for a second straight year this weekend!  Competitors from across Canada will be fighting it out for their share of the $11,000 purse and title of 2013 National Champions!

 

Local favorites and 2012 18U Champions, Nicole and Megan McNamara of South Surrey will look to continue their winning ways at National Championships in their first year in the Senior Competition. The 16 year old identical twins have attracted a lot of attention on the pro-circuit in 2013 after taking third place at the high-profile ClearlyContacts.ca Open in July, followed by a silver medal last week at the Canada Games in Quebec. Standing in their way will be the Canada Games Gold medalists Sophie Bukovec and Ali Woolley of Toronto, Ontario, as well as 2013 BC Provincial Champions Liz Cordonier and Leah Allinger-Pezer of Vancouver, BC.

 

On the Men’s side Aaron Nusbaum of Toronto, Ontario looks a strong favorite for his first National title after winning World U21 silver in Croatia this June with Grant O’Gorman. Playing with new team mate Will Sidgwick, a fellow Queen’s and Canada representative – the pair will be tough to beat. With BC born 2012 National Champion Maverick Hatch competing overseas currently, BC hopes rest with Provincial Champion and TRU star Krzysztof Orman who pairs up with National B team and former TWU player Steven Marshall.

 

The tournament will also feature the top youth teams from across Canada, competing in 14U, 16U, 18U and 21U divisions. With several BC teams taking part, the local athletes will hope to use the home advantage against some very strong travelling teams. Partnerships to look out for are BC 18U champions – Surrey’s Chloe Stone and Vancouver’s Sara Pantovic as well as 17U winners from Vancouver Island Victoria Behie and Sara Chase in the Girls’ competition and 2013 UBC recruits Irvan Brar and Matt Guidi and BC Silver medalists from the Okanagan, Logan Mend and Blair Anderson in the Boys’ event.

 

In total there will be 67 courts, 207 teams and 414 athletes at the biggest beach volleyball tournament ever held in Western Canada.  The championships are free to the public and fans are encouraged to come and check it out!  The event features free prize giveaways, interactive crowd activities, and some of the best beach volleyball action in North America – don’t miss out!

 

“We are very excited to welcome Canada’s best players to Vancouver once again in 2013,” commented Chris Densmore, Executive Director at Volleyball BC. “Volleyball BC are proud to act as host for the 25th annual National Beach Volleyball Championships at one of the most picturesque beaches in Canada, and I’d like to wish all the teams competing the very best of luck!”
